Q

First Continental Congress
What were their goals?

A

.They wanted to show support for Boston after the Intolerable Acts
.Send a letter to King George expressing their concerns and find a solution
.Would meet in May 1775 if British didn’t meet their demands

Q

What was the Albany plan

A

Benjamin Franklin thought the colonies should work together to defeat France. He proposed that each colony would still have its government but they would also make one big government to decide more important issues. The colonists did not accept it because they did not want to unify into one government.
